Python中文
首页
教程
问答
标签
搜索
登录
注册
在目录中创建带有日期时间名称和子文件的dir(Python)
回答此问题可获得
20
贡献值,回答如果被采纳可获得
50
分。
<p>我目前正在使用pythonv2.7在Linux上创建一个目录,目录名为日期和时间(即27-10-2011 23:00:01)。我的密码是以下:在</p> <pre><code>import time import os dirfmt = "/root/%4d-%02d-%02d %02d:%02d:%02d" dirname = dirfmt % time.localtime()[0:6] os.mkdir(dirname) </code></pre> <p>这段代码可以正常工作,并根据请求生成目录。尽管如此,我还想在这个目录中创建两个csv文件和一个同名的日志文件。现在,由于目录名是动态生成的,我不确定如何移动到这个目录来创建这些文件。我希望目录和三个文件都有相同的名称(csv文件将以字母作为前缀)。例如,考虑到上述情况,我希望创建一个名为“27-10-2011 23:00:01”的目录,然后在其中创建两个名为“a27-10-2011 23:00:01.csv”和“b27-10-2011 23:00:01.csv”的csv文件和名为“27-10-2011 23:00:01.log”的日志文件。在</p> <p>我的文件创建代码是以下:在</p> ^{pr2}$ <p>有什么建议可以让第二个在整个过程中保持不变?我很感激这段代码只需要一瞬间就能运行,但在这段时间内,秒可能会改变。我想关键在于改变时间.本地时间“但我仍然不确定。在</p> <p>谢谢</p>
0 条评论
分类:
Python问答
请先
登录
后评论
默认排序
时间排序
1 个回答
匿名
1天前
擅长:python、mysql、java
<p>只调用<code>time.localtime</code>一次。在</p> <pre><code>current_time = time.localtime()[0:6] csvafile = csvafmt % current_time csvbfile = csvbfmt % current_time logfile = logfmt % current_time </code></pre>
请先
登录
后评论
针对此问题:
更多的回答
关注
89
关注
收藏
1
收藏,
216
浏览
网友 提问于 2天前
相关Python问题
为什么在使用strptime时会出现未进行转换的数据错误?
4 回答
为什么在使用strptim时会出现这个datetime日期错误
8 回答
为什么在使用StyleFrame时索引列的标题不显示sf.至excel()?
10 回答
为什么在使用sum()函数时会发生“int”对象不可调用的错误?
5 回答
为什么在使用sympy.dsolve时会得到“'list'对象没有属性'func'”?
7 回答
为什么在使用tabla时会得到一个空的数据帧?
1 回答
为什么在使用tensorboard时需要add_graph()的第二个参数?
5 回答
为什么在使用TensorFlow Lite转换YOLOv4时,推断时间/大小没有改进?有什么可能的改进吗?
5 回答
为什么在使用Tensorflow加载训练批时会出现内存泄漏?
1 回答
为什么在使用tensorflow时会收到警告/错误(使用函数API,但未实现错误)
3 回答
为什么在使用tetpyclient发出POST请求时出现403错误?
4 回答
为什么在使用TextBlob时会出现HTTP错误?
10 回答
为什么在使用TFIDF时出现错误“IndexError:list index out of range”pyspark.ml.feature?
2 回答
为什么在使用timedelta格式化之后,我在python中的日期是错误的?
5 回答
为什么在使用timeit或exec函数时,函数中的变量不会在提供的全局命名空间中搜索?
5 回答
为什么在使用tkinter时不能使用复选框?
8 回答
为什么在使用todoistpythonapi时会返回这个奇怪的ID?
3 回答
为什么在使用TQM时,在调整图像大小时,处理时间会有很大的差异?
6 回答
为什么在使用Tweepy下载用户时间线时收到错误消息
8 回答
为什么在使用twitter帐户登录Django应用程序时重定向127.0.0.1:8000?
3 回答